if your car is lowered you will be wanting to ask for a split bed. Those are the ones that are designed for lowered cars. Last time we had to tow a friends 86 and we got a normal flat bed and they said it was too low so they sent us a split bed. Towed that thing no problem, didn't even scratch the bumper.
